Newsgroups: php.internals Path: news.php.net Xref: news.php.net php.internals:20627 Return-Path: Mailing-List: contact internals-help@lists.php.net; run by ezmlm Delivered-To: mailing list internals@lists.php.net Received: (qmail 93163 invoked by uid 1010); 27 Nov 2005 02:45:23 -0000 Delivered-To: ezmlm-scan-internals@lists.php.net Delivered-To: ezmlm-internals@lists.php.net Received: (qmail 93144 invoked from network); 27 Nov 2005 02:45:23 -0000 Received: from unknown (HELO lists.php.net) (127.0.0.1) by localhost with SMTP; 27 Nov 2005 02:45:23 -0000 X-Host-Fingerprint: 66.249.82.206 xproxy.gmail.com Linux 2.4/2.6 Received: from ([66.249.82.206:29690] helo=xproxy.gmail.com) by pb1.pair.com (ecelerity 2.0 beta r(6323M)) with SMTP id DE/8E-56276-2CD19834 for ; Sat, 26 Nov 2005 21:45:22 -0500 Received: by xproxy.gmail.com with SMTP id r21so4012568wxc for ; Sat, 26 Nov 2005 18:45:19 -0800 (PST) DomainKey-Signature: a=rsa-sha1; q=dns; c=nofws; s=beta; d=gmail.com; h=received:message-id:date:from:to:subject:in-reply-to:mime-version:content-type:content-transfer-encoding:content-disposition:references; b=Dou2FV2CtaQH+IsCS8OZna8Pt6+ydRFlIk/ZI4W7aRtZ1L27TEpib+w5hYCs1wGapvDuus8cFdlkQxdnpYqFBuqNk4Bp49P22bZk/OD0zO9oAjRgD8O6/Zuj/S6+ayn5Jh6m8gJtM0rMp3CfuRzC0H97n54jZx5+Ca9pW0dLQek= Received: by 10.65.235.5 with SMTP id m5mr44570qbr; Sat, 26 Nov 2005 18:45:19 -0800 (PST) Received: by 10.65.44.6 with HTTP; Sat, 26 Nov 2005 18:45:19 -0800 (PST) Message-ID: Date: Sat, 26 Nov 2005 21:45:19 -0500 To: internals@lists.php.net In-Reply-To: MIME-Version: 1.0 Content-Type: text/plain; charset=ISO-8859-1 Content-Transfer-Encoding: quoted-printable Content-Disposition: inline References: <20.BA.56276.A1BC8834@pb1.pair.com> <31.BC.56276.1C519834@pb1.pair.com> <4389182E.6080404@gmail.com> Subject: Re: [PHP-DEV] Re: namespace separator ideas From: matt.friedman@gmail.com (Matt Friedman) Could I kindly get the grid as an attachment? Gmail messed up the formattin= g. On 11/26/05, Eric Coleman wrote: > If : is still a viable solution, i'd much rather see that used :P > > -- Eric > -- > Eric Coleman > > On Nov 26, 2005, at 9:21 PM, Jessie Hernandez wrote: > > > Great work, Oliver! I personally also add a +1 for ":", with the > > whitespace restriction in the ternary operator (or just removing > > namespace constants). > > > > I would also add another restriction: you cannot more than one > > point for/against (so no +2's or -2's, etc.). It just doesn't make > > sense (I might as well do +4000000 for whatever I want :-) ). > > > > > > Regards, > > > > Jessie > > > > > > > > Oliver Gr=E4tz wrote: > >> OK, you requested for it! *g* > >> OLLi > >> --------------------------------------------------------------------- > >> --- > >> Namespace Operators > >> =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D > >> =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D > >> Name |s| %% | : | ::: | ::< | :< | <- | :> | > >> \ | -> | \\ | <:: | <: | .. | | | | > >> ---------------------+-+-----+-----+-----+-----+-----+-----+----- > >> +-----+-----+-----+-----+-----+-----+-----+-----+-----+ > >> Robert Deaton |-| +0 | | -1 | | | -2 | +1 > >> | | | | | | | | | | Alan > >> Knowles |-| | +1 | | | | | | > >> | | | | | | | | | > >> Greg Beaver |-| | +0 | +0 | +0 | +0 | | +0 | > >> +0 | +1 | +1 | +0 | +0 | | | | | > >> Jessie Hernandez |-| +1 | | +2 | | | | > >> | | | | | | | | | | > >> Matt Friedman |-| | | -1 | | | +1 | | > >> -1 | | | +1 | +1 | | | | | > >> David Z=FClke |-| | | +2 | | | +1 | -1 > >> | | | | | -1 | | | | | > >> Oliver Gr=E4tz |*| +2 | | +1 | | | | > >> | | | | | | | | | | > >> Matthew C. Kavanagh |-| -1 | | | | | | > >> | | | | | | | | | | > >> Jasper Bryant-Greene |-| | | | | -1 | +1 | -1 > >> | | | | | -1 | | | | | > >> Eric Coleman |-| -1 | | | | | +1 | +1 | > >> -1 | | | | | | | | | > >> Christian Stocker |-| | | | | -1 | | -1 | > >> +1 | | | | -1 | | | | | > >> Stanislav Malyshev |-| | | | | | | > >> | | | | | | | | | | > >> Jared Williams |-| | | | | | | > >> | | +1 | | | | | | | | > >> Jason Garber | | | | | | | | > >> | | | | | | +1 | | | | > >> | | | | | | | | > >> | | | | | | | | | | > >> ---------------------+-+-----+-----+-----+-----+-----+-----+----- > >> +-----+-----+-----+-----+-----+-----+-----+-----+-----+ > >> sum | | +1 | +1 | +3 | +0 | -2 | +2 | -1 | > >> -1 | +2 | +1 | +1 | -2 | +1 | | | | > >> =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D > >> =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D > >> Notes: > >> - I took > >> +2 as "likes" > >> +1 as "is fine with" > >> +0 as "can live with" > >> -1 as "dislikes" > >> - The "s" column stands for "self-filled". I compiled the current > >> table from the comments in this newsgroup, so perhaps I didn't > >> get their comments right. - The operators : <- -> could make big > >> problems with the parser. > >> More complaints to follow. *g* > >> - Feel free to add new suggestions to the right. > >> - If you add your name at the bottom, please copy the free line > >> so the next one also has a free one. > >> - Do only edit the votes in *your* line! > >> - Correct the sums if you post. > >> - Please post as attachment! > >> If some of the operators are definitely impossible to implement, > >> please put the headline of column in parentheses (as in "(<-)") > >> ans add a note why this operator can't be done (Hi Marcus *g*). > > > > Namespace Operators > > =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D > > =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D > > Name |s| %% | : | ::: | ::< | :< | <- | :> | > > \ | -> | \\ | <:: | <: | .. | | | | > > ---------------------+-+-----+-----+-----+-----+-----+-----+----- > > +-----+-----+-----+-----+-----+-----+-----+-----+-----+ > > Robert Deaton |-| +0 | | -1 | | | -2 | +1 > > | | | | | | | | | | > > Alan Knowles |-| | +1 | | | | | > > | | | | | | | | | | > > Greg Beaver |-| | +0 | +0 | +0 | +0 | | +0 | > > +0 | +1 | +1 | +0 | +0 | | | | | > > Jessie Hernandez |-| +1 | +1 | +1 | | | | > > | | | | | | | | | | > > Matt Friedman |-| | | -1 | | | +1 | | > > -1 | | | +1 | +1 | | | | | > > David Z=FClke |-| | | +2 | | | +1 | -1 > > | | | | | -1 | | | | | > > Oliver Gr=E4tz |*| +2 | | +1 | | | | > > | | | | | | | | | | > > Matthew C. Kavanagh |-| -1 | | | | | | > > | | | | | | | | | | > > Jasper Bryant-Greene |-| | | | | -1 | +1 | -1 > > | | | | | -1 | | | | | > > Eric Coleman |-| -1 | | | | | +1 | +1 | > > -1 | | | | | | | | | > > Christian Stocker |-| | | | | -1 | | -1 | > > +1 | | | | -1 | | | | | > > Stanislav Malyshev |-| | | | | | | > > | | | | | | | | | | > > Jared Williams |-| | | | | | | > > | | +1 | | | | | | | | > > Jason Garber | | | | | | | | > > | | | | | | +1 | | | | > > | | | | | | | | > > | | | | | | | | | | > > ---------------------+-+-----+-----+-----+-----+-----+-----+----- > > +-----+-----+-----+-----+-----+-----+-----+-----+-----+ > > sum | | +1 | +1 | +3 | +0 | -2 | +2 | -1 | > > -1 | +2 | +1 | +1 | -2 | +1 | | | | > > =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D > > =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D > > > > -- > > PHP Internals - PHP Runtime Development Mailing List > > To unsubscribe, visit: http://www.php.net/unsub.php > > -- > PHP Internals - PHP Runtime Development Mailing List > To unsubscribe, visit: http://www.php.net/unsub.php > > -- -- Matt Friedman